What is a Slide Sheet??
A slide sheet is a low-friction fabric tool designed to help move, reposition, or turn a patient safely across a flat surface such as a bed, trolley, or operating table. It reduces the physical effort needed by carers by allowing the patient to glide smoothly, instead of being dragged or lifted. Slide sheets are essential for protecting patient skin integrity, preserving dignity during movement, and reducing the risk of musculoskeletal injuries to carers.
Why are Slide Sheets Needed?
Traditional manual repositioning methods place significant strain on carers and can lead to injuries such as back strain, shoulder damage, or repetitive strain disorders. For patients, improper handling can cause shear forces, skin tears, bruising, and loss of dignity. Slide sheets dramatically reduce friction and the amount of force needed to move a patient, making it safer, faster, and more comfortable for everyone involved. They are a key tool in meeting modern manual handling policies, improving patient care outcomes, and protecting the long-term health of the workforce.
Why Choose Jeenie Slide Sheets?
The Jeenie1 and Jeenie4 Slide Sheets have been carefully designed to balance effective patient handling with modern care values, offering safer, more inclusive solutions for carers and patients alike:
-
Inclusive by design – both sheets use the same colour to promote dignity and avoid singling out patient size; subtle handle colours differentiate the models (red for Jeenie1, black for Jeenie4)
-
Size options for tailored care – Jeenie1 measures 100cm x 230cm for standard needs, while Jeenie4 offers an extra-wide 140cm x 230cm for patients requiring additional support
-
Smooth, multi-directional movement – low-friction surface allows movement in any direction for repositioning, turning, and lateral transfers
-
Minimised shear and friction – during lateral transfers, the patient is supported between two fabric layers, allowing kinetic motion that reduces the risk of shear injuries
-
Handles for control and support – reinforced handles offer close control during movement and can be attached to a hoist for assisted turning where appropriate
-
Hoist compatibility for proportional care – supports carer wellbeing, enabling turning assistance without full manual handling; particularly helpful for carers with arthritis or reduced hand strength
-
Strong and safe – strength-rated for assisted turning of patients up to 350kg under proper risk assessment
-
Infection control and sustainability – available in both washable and single-patient-use (SPU) versions to suit different care environments
